Spark creating huge errors.log file

Hi

Running Spark 2.7.1 in a Windows 2008 R2 Citrix environment. Sometimes (seems random as the users claim they have not done unusual with Spark) spark.exe will start using 100% of its available CPU and create a huge errors.log file in %AppData%\Roaming\Spark\logs. Spark keeps generating the log file until the disk is full and will keep going until the .exe is manually terminated.

If you are using full installer, then Spark has its own Java built-in. 2.7.1 had latest version of Java 7. Starting with 2.7.2 it is bundled with latest versions of Java 8.

Java being used by Spark can be checked in the About window.
